#c31203 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c31203 is composed of 76.5% red, 7.1%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.8% magenta, 98.5%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 4.7 degrees, a saturation of 97% and a lightness of 38.8%. #c31203 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2406 with #870000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#c31203 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c31203 has RGB values of R:195, G:18,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.98,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12784131.

Shades and Tints of #c31203
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020000 is the darkest color, while #ffefee is the lightest one.
